Window remodeling services involve the replacement or upgrading of existing windows to improve a property's app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ency. These services typically include removing outdated or damaged windows and installing new units that better suit the architectural style and performance needs of a property. Contractors may offer a variety of window styles, such as double-hung, casement, picture, or bay windows, allowing property owners to customize their upgrades to match aesthetic preferences and practical requirements.
One of the primary issues window remodeling addresses is energy loss. Old or poorly sealed windows can lead to increased heating and cooling costs by allowing drafts and heat transfer. Remodeling can help resolve these problems by installing modern, energy-efficient windows that provide better insulation and reduce utility expenses. Additionally, window upgrades can improve soundproofing, reduce outdoor noise infiltration, and enhance overall comfort within a property, making the indoor environment more pleasant year-round.

Window Replacement Costs - The cost for replacing windows typ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size, style, and materials. For example, a standard double-pane window may fall within the $400 to $700 range. Prices can vary based on the complexity of installation and window type.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for window remodeling services usually account for 50% to 60% of the total project price. In Lake Stevens, local pros may charge between $50 and $100 per hour, with total labor costs often between $200 and $800 per window. These rates depend on the scope of work and accessibility.
Material Costs - Materials such as vinyl, wood, or aluminum frames influence overall costs, which can range from $150 to $1,200 per window. Higher-end materials like custom wood frames tend to increase the price, while standard vinyl options are generally more affordable.
Additional Fees - Extra charges may include removing old windows, upgrading insulation, or custom framing, which can add $100 to $500 per window. These costs vary based on the existing structure and specific project requ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
